Default Fishing licence

My husband needs a boat fishing licence. He asked the Guardia Civil and they told him to do it online, pay online and print off the licence yourself. Has anyone got a link to the appropriate website please, as he has had a few problems finding the right website?

Found this online
"A fishing license is required in Majorca for anyone of 14 years or over. However, any chartered fishing trips will be covered by a 'collective' or 'boat' license, thus you will not need to purchase a license yourself."

If he still does need one the webpage is as follows

"You can also order your license online at dgpesca.caib.es. It can take up to 1 month for the license to be issued this way and you will still need to collect it in person from the office, remembering to take your ID with you.

In order to get a license you will need to provide some form of identification. For Spanish residents this can be your DNI or NIE, for tourists your passport is accepted. Your fishing license will make reference to your DNI, NIE or passport. When you are fishing you must carry both your license and the ID you used to obtain the license. This enables the authorities to cross check your fishing license with the photo ID in order or make sure the license belongs to you (i.e. to prevent multiple people using the same license)."

A member has kindly sent me the following information :-

This link to a website https://www.caib.es/seucaib/es/tramites/tramite/98088.

However he advises that it's best to go to Inca, here is the address :-
Carrer Selleters, 07300 Inca, Illes Balears it's the Ministry of Agriculture and Fishing.

I should also point out that this is only necessary if it's for his own boat, if he is going on an organised boat fishing trip the boat owner will already have the license.
